CLOVIS POINT  

Mahieu Diploid 98-803 SG
[PARLOR GAME X PERSIAN PATTERN]
42 M 9 DOR, 5 way branching, 25 buds 4.5:1 SPIDER VARIANT fertile both ways

This clear cadmium orange-melon variant has a very splashy, brushed oxblood eye.  The shape of the eye chevrons on the petals reminded me of the fluted Clovis points the first Americans used to kill mammoths!  The throat color is gold to olive green.  CLOVIS POINT makes a very loud garden statement and offers a great improvement in branching and budcount for this color class. The form is often cascading and much more artistic than these photos.
